ZIP code 07624 in Closter, New Jersey has a population of 8,373. The median household income is $190,469, which is 150% above the national average. Median home value is $871,300, 213% above the US average. 66.3%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

ZIP code 07624 is classified by USPS as a standard delivery area and covers roughly 8.1 square miles in Closter, Bergen County, New Jersey. The area is home to 8,373 residents, producing a population density of 1,028 people per square mile, and falls within the New York time zone. These USPS and Census boundary values drive every downstream statistic on this page, including the benchmarks that compare 07624 against New Jersey and the nation.

On the economic side, the median household income for ZIP 07624 sits at $190,469 (56% above the New Jersey average), while per-capita income is $79,250. The poverty rate stands at 8.1% and the unemployment rate at 3.3%. On housing, the median home value is $871,300 (69% above the state average) with median rent at $2,721 per month, and 81.5% of occupied units are owner-occupied, a direct signal of whether 07624 behaves more like a homeowner neighborhood or a renter-heavy ZIP.

Education and household profile round out the picture: 66.3%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, the median age is 39.8, and the average commute is 33 minutes. Home values in ZIP 07624 have increased 7.1% over the past year (2024). Since 2000, this ZIP has seen +154% cumulative appreciation.

Census Bureau data shows 473 business establishments in ZIP 07624, employing approximately 3,943 people with a combined annual payroll of $182,382,000.
